随着科学技术的发展,人们对产品质量的要求越来越高,这就伴随着对产品的可靠性要求也越来越高。产品的可靠性是设计和制造出来的,首先是设计出来的。设计决定产品的固有可靠性,而且设计上的不足很难在批量生产和使用阶段来弥补,有的产品甚至由于设计不合理而无法使用。产品设计一经完成,产品固有可靠性就基本确定。如何保证达到产品的固有可靠性,这是生产和制造中所要解决的问题。产品的可靠性是指产品在规定的使用条件下和规定的时间内完成规定功能的能力,它是表征产品质量的一项重要指标,是产品正常工作的基础,产品的功能再强,性能再高,如果使用中总是出故障,这就不算是好产品。本文主要分析电子产品在生产和制造中如何保证达到其固有可靠性水平。
